@jwolcott, no prob!
Yeah… that’s usually the right way to go about it. Unfortunately, this problem is in the details. Just based on what output you’ve shown, it looks like the autodiff isn’t actually working. Maybe trace through and make sure everything is using the correct types?
Understood.
Great. If you look in Stan’s unit tests, there are simple tests that demonstrate calling the different functions. Maybe that’ll clue you in on what’s happening?